Acts 6:7-15

Stephen's persecution prompts us to evaluate our own commitment to our beliefs. Are we sometimes silent when we should speak out? Imagine standing before a group, proclaiming truth, when suddenly you encounter hostility. This is where faith is tested. Stephen faced such hostility with grace and bravery. His story encourages us to reflect on our willingness to endure discomfort and rejection for the sake of the Gospel—a powerful challenge for both adults and teens in their daily lives. In this text we see Stephen a preaching deacon, doing the will of God. The bible says he was selected by the disciples to work as a distributor of food for the widows. Satan tried to sow the seeds of division between the Grecians and Hebrews in the way food was being distributed amongst the widows. He tried to separate the disciples from the word of God to serve tables. But God’s wisdom as always prevails. Further in the text in verse 7 says the word of God increased, disciples multiplied greatly in Jerusalem even the priest who didn’t believe in Jesus became obedient to the faith.
PURSUE OBEDIENCE TO THE WORD (vs7 & 8 )In verses 7 & 8 Stephen was identified as a man who was full of faith and power. He was not afraid to speak up for God. Even in the face of persecution. He was full of the Holy Ghost. All seven. By instruction they were told to find seven men of honest report and full of the Holy Ghost .Then the word of God increased after prayer. But how did the word of God increase. Well the text says disciples multiplied and priests were obedient to the faith. These men became obedient to the word. You can’t spread the word until you become obedient to the word. We are to pursue after the word and be filled with it. This is how we become spiritually healthy. The only way you become stronger in the word is by pursuing the word and be fed by it. (Pursue after wisdom vs 9-11) There were certain men who tried to dispute Stephen but his power and wisdom was to strong for them to resist. When God anoints you for a task he equips us for that task. But there are times no matter how much you speak the truth, there are those who will dispute and despise you because of who and what you stand for. I want to believe that these men who disputed Stephen were just like the men who disputed Jesus. Jealousy and hate will make people fight against you, an not only that they will lie on you. Pursue Faithfulness over Fairness vs12-14
How many in here know GREAT FAITH DOSEN’T GARUNTEE FAIR TREATMENT. If you don’t believe it ask your Pastor or ask me. We can testify to that. Anybody who’s been faithful to God will be mistreated some kind of way. Stephen was carried before the council Just as his Savior was, people were paid to lie on Stephen just as Jesus was betrayed for 30 pieces of silver. There’s a lie running rampant in our church’s today, that lie says if you have enough faith you’ll be healthy, rich and successful, this was certainly not the case with Stephen. Maybe if he had been a little more faithful his trouble would have ceased. But that’s not what the word of God says In this life you will have trails and tribulations, 1 Peter 1:7 “That the trial of your faith, being much more precious than of gold that perisheth, though it be tried with fire, might be found unto praise and honor and glory at the appearing of Jesus Christ:” Stephen was tried by fire, He stood the test, he took the insults and lie his faith was tested and he stood strong for the Lord, we as God’s people have to stand strong now for our reward is in heaven waiting for us if we faint not. Pursed A Radiant Relationship with Christ vs 15
As he sat in the midst of the council , the bible says the council looked steadfast on him, saw his face as it had been the face of an angel. After all the accusations the Sanhedrin council were waiting for a response. His face gave the response they would never understand. His face glowed with the radiancy of Christ. Sometimes what you don’t say says everything, but how many know that at the right moment God will give you what he want’s said and done. They thought they had shut him down with their lies, with their tricks, with their false witnesses ( The Story called Checkmate). in Chp. 7 he tells them about their disloyalty to God after he had saved them so many time how they killed all the messengers of God, how God brought them out of Egypt how they were stiff necked and had uncircumcised hearts. How they even killed the just one Jesus. And when they could not take his words anymore they stoned him to death. But there is a parallel in something Step[hen said before they stoned him and what Jesus said. Lord lay not this sin to their charge , his lord before giving up the Ghost said Forgive them for they know not what they do.
